从前段时间开始,由于项目需要,开始研究OpenHEVC. 于是在GitHub上面将OpenHEVC整个工程fork到我自己的账号下,并clone到了电脑上.
按照OpenHEVC的ReadMe文件上面的教程在终端界面很顺利就将OpenHEVC配置好,能够顺利解码. 接下来为了更好的调试阅读代码,打算将OpenHEVC在Eclipse里面配置,结果弄了蛮久才成功,下面将在Eclipse上的配置过程记录下来.
1.第一步:导入工程
首先打开Eclipse, WorkSpace可以按自己需求决定.
然后点击File选项-->点击Import选项. 出来图1所示窗口,打开C/C++文件,选择Existing code as Autotools projext, 点击Next,进入如图二所示窗口,点击Browse将openHEVC导进来,再点击Finish即可,成功导入工程.
图1
图2
第二步:配置参数
导入工程之后,我们需要配置相应的参数,工程才能跑起来.
首先,右键点击工程openHEVC,打开窗口Properties(直接按快捷键 Alt + Enter 也可以),这里有两个地方需要配置,分别是:
C/C++ Build选项下的Build command ,配置为 make -j4,这样做可以提高编译速度;
以及Build directory ,在作者的电脑里配置为/home/lb/openHEVC/build,这一步很重要,这是给IDE指明工程的makefile文件,只有知道这个,才能正确编译链接.而这个makefile文件,我们之前按照ReadMe文件的步骤已经生成.